怎么把项目部署到服务器上面,深度解析,如何高效地将项目部署到服务器上——全方位指南
- 综合资讯
- 2024-11-22 14:58:02
- 2

高效部署项目至服务器:全方位指南,深度解析部署流程,涵盖环境搭建、配置优化、自动化部署等关键步骤,助您轻松实现项目快速上线。...
高效部署项目至服务器:全方位指南,深度解析部署流程,涵盖环境搭建、配置优化、自动化部署等关键步骤,助您轻松实现项目快速上线。
随着互联网技术的飞速发展,越来越多的企业选择将项目部署到服务器上,以实现业务的高效运转,对于很多初学者来说,如何将项目部署到服务器上仍然是一个难题,本文将详细解析如何高效地将项目部署到服务器上,帮助您轻松实现项目的上线。
选择合适的服务器
1、确定服务器类型:根据项目需求,选择合适的云服务器或物理服务器,云服务器具有成本低、易于扩展、快速部署等优势,而物理服务器则更适合对性能要求较高的项目。
2、服务器配置:根据项目需求,选择合适的CPU、内存、硬盘等配置,确保服务器性能满足项目需求,避免因服务器配置不足导致项目运行不稳定。
3、服务器地理位置:选择距离目标用户较近的服务器,以降低延迟,提高用户体验。
准备项目文件
1、项目源码:将项目源码整理成压缩包,方便上传到服务器。
2、依赖包:确保项目所需的依赖包都已安装,并将依赖包的版本信息记录在项目文档中。
3、配置文件:将项目配置文件整理成压缩包,方便上传到服务器。
配置服务器环境
1、安装操作系统:根据服务器类型,选择合适的操作系统,如Linux或Windows。
2、安装服务器软件:根据项目需求,安装相应的服务器软件,如Apache、Nginx、MySQL等。
3、配置服务器环境:根据项目需求,配置服务器环境,如设置防火墙规则、优化系统性能等。
上传项目文件
1、使用FTP、SFTP、SCP等工具上传项目文件到服务器。
2、解压项目文件:在服务器上解压项目文件,将其放置到相应的目录。
部署项目
1、安装依赖包:在服务器上安装项目所需的依赖包。
2、配置项目:根据项目需求,配置项目参数,如数据库连接信息、日志配置等。
3、启动项目:启动项目,确保项目正常运行。
测试项目
1、测试项目功能:在服务器上测试项目功能,确保项目功能正常。
2、性能测试:对项目进行性能测试,确保项目在高并发情况下仍能稳定运行。
3、安全测试:对项目进行安全测试,确保项目不存在安全隐患。
优化项目
1、代码优化:对项目代码进行优化,提高项目性能。
2、系统优化:优化服务器系统,提高服务器性能。
3、缓存优化:使用缓存技术,提高项目访问速度。
通过以上步骤,您已经成功将项目部署到服务器上,在实际操作过程中,可能还会遇到各种问题,需要根据实际情况进行调整,以下是一些常见问题的解决方案:
1、服务器访问速度慢:检查服务器网络配置,优化服务器性能。
2、项目无法启动:检查项目配置文件,确保配置正确。
3、项目功能异常:检查项目代码,查找问题所在。
4、项目安全漏洞:定期对项目进行安全检查,修复漏洞。
将项目部署到服务器上需要耐心和细心,只要掌握好以上步骤,相信您一定能够高效地将项目部署到服务器上,实现业务的高效运转。
本文链接:https://www.zhitaoyun.cn/1002890.html
发表评论